AI infrastructure startup
An AI startup faced unpredictable GPU demand and noisy clusters. We re-architected their Kubernetes platform for efficient scaling, better scheduling, and cost controls aligned to growth.
The situation
Rapid model experimentation created bursty GPU usage and unpredictable costs. The platform team lacked clear guardrails for scaling and had limited visibility into workload efficiency.
Stabilized reliability while lowering cloud spend by ~20%.
How we worked
Stabilise delivery early, then build the foundation that keeps it stable once we hand it back.
Segmented workloads into dedicated node pools with tailored scaling policies and instance mixes.
Introduced GPU-aware scheduling, bin packing, and quotas to stabilize utilization.
Built FinOps dashboards and budget alerts tied to team ownership.
Added SLOs, alerting, and runbooks for GPU-intensive workloads.
